The Villa at Texarkana is an assisted living community located in Texarkana, TX. This community provides a range of amenities and care services to ensure the comfort and well-being of its residents.
The community offers a variety of amenities to enhance the quality of life for its residents. There is a beauty salon on-site, as well as cable or satellite TV in each apartment. Community-operated transportation is available for residents to easily access off-site activities and appointments. For those who enjoy technology, there is a computer center and Wi-Fi/high-speed internet throughout the community. The dining room offers restaurant-style dining with delicious meals prepared by the staff.
Residents also have access to several recreational spaces within the community, including a fitness room, gaming room, outdoor garden, small library, and wellness center. Housekeeping services are provided to ensure that residents can enjoy a clean and organized living environment.
Care services are available around-the-clock to meet the individual needs of each resident. A 24-hour call system and supervision provide peace of mind for both residents and their families. Ass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ers is readily available. Medication management and diabetes diet options are offered to promote health and well-being.
The Villa at Texarkana prioritizes residents' socialization and engagement by offering various activities on a daily basis. Residents can participate in fitness programs, concierge services, planned day trips, resident-run activities, and scheduled daily activities.

Comprehensive Guide to Medicare Coverage for Hospice Care
Hospice care focuses on providing comfort and support for individuals nearing the end of life, with Medicare Part A covering services like nursing care and counseling for patients with a terminal illness and a life expectancy of six months or less. While most hospice services are low-cost for eligible patients, families should be aware that certain expenses, such as room and board, may not be covered.
Caring for Those Who Care: Recognizing, Understanding, and Overcoming Caregiver Burnout
Caregiver burnout is a common issue resulting from the intense physical, emotional, and mental demands of caregiving, leading to symptoms like fatigue and social withdrawal. To prevent burnout, caregivers should recognize early warning signs and implement self-care strategies, seek support, and prioritize their own well-being alongside that of those they care for.
